免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发单子

App开发是制作移动设备上运行的应用程序的过程。由于移动设备通常是指便携式设备,如智能手机和平板电脑等,因此App开发通常涉及使用特定的开发工具和技术来设计,开发和测试这些设备上运行的应用程序。此外,由于移动设备的操作系统和硬件配置不同,因此开发者需要为不同的操作系统和设备进行开发。

在App开发之前,开发者需要进行思考和设计。他们需要了解用户想要哪些功能和界面,以及如何使应用程序易于使用和易于理解。根据这些需求,开发者可以使用多种开发工具和技术进行开发。

首先,开发者可以使用现成的应用程序开发工具,如Xcode和Android Studio等。这些开发工具提供了一组内置工具,可以用来创建用户界面,处理数据和编写代码来实现功能。在开发过程中,开发者可以利用这些工具来不断地测试和修改应用程序,以确保应用程序具有平稳的运行和良好的用户体验。

其次,开发者可以使用各种开发语言和框架进行开发。常用的语言包括Java、Swift、HTML、CSS和JavaScript。这些语言可以用于处理数据和编写应用程序的逻辑功能。此外,框架如React Native和SwiftUI等提供了一些现成的组件,用于处理用户界面和应用程序的逻辑。开发者可以使用这些框架来加快开发过程,同时提供更好的应用程序体验。

最后,开发者还需要进行应用程序的测试和调试。在测试期间,他们应确保应用程序能够处理不同的用户场景,如慢速网络连接和不同的设备屏幕尺寸。此外,还需要进行安全测试,以确保应用程序没有潜在的漏洞和安全隐患。

综上所述,开发App需要做的工作非常多。除了开发技术和工具之外,还需要开发者具备很好的分析能力、设计能力和沟通能力,以制定用户满意的应用程序。只有这样,才能开发出平稳运行且受用户欢迎的应用程序。


相关知识:
如何开发app架构
开发一个高质量的app需要良好的架构设计。一个好的架构设计能够提高应用程序的可维护性,可扩展性和可测试性,同时也能够减少后期维护成本。本文将介绍app架构的原理和详细介绍。一、app架构的原理1. 模块化设计模块化设计是指将应用程序分解为多个独立的模块,每
2024-01-10
app移动商城开发
移动商城(App商城)开发是一种基于移动应用开发技术,建立在移动设备上的电子商务平台。这种商城可以将商品展示、购买、付款和物流等功能集合在一起,方便用户随时随地进行购物。移动商城开发的核心工作包括前端开发、后端开发、数据库设计和服务器部署等方面。下面将从这
2023-07-14
app原生开发工具
App原生开发工具指的是使用特定编程语言和框架来开发原生应用程序的工具。原生应用程序是指使用特定平台本身提供的工具和API进行开发,以实现最高的性能和用户体验。以下是几种常见的App原生开发工具:1. iOS原生开发工具(Xcode): Xcode是苹
2023-07-14
app开发加载功能
App加载功能是指从服务器获取应用程序的数据并将其装载到设备上的过程。这个过程涉及到很多技术和原理,以下是一个详细的介绍。1. 应用程序安装包一个应用程序被打包成一个安装包(.apk文件),安装包包含了所有的应用程序代码和静态资源。当用户点击“下载”按钮时
2023-06-29
app导航开发
App导航通常是应用程序界面的一部分,它提供了一些到应用程序的各个部分和功能的快速和方便的访问方式。一般而言,这个导航条在应用程序的页面顶部,但是有时它可能在页面的其他位置,例如侧边栏或者底部。因此,它是用户可以在应用程序中方便地找到他们感兴趣的内容的重要
2023-05-06
android开发app出现异常重启
在Android开发中,应用程序会出现异常重启的情况,这可能是由于程序代码中的错误、设备内存不足或其他因素引起的。在这篇文章中,我们将介绍为什么Android应用程序会出现异常重启、如何避免异常重启,以及如果必须处理异常重启,我们应该如何调试和修复它们。一
2023-05-06